After a long wait for season 2, the third installment of Netflix’s second most successful series ever might land sooner than expected
Tim Burton’s gothic mystery Wednesday took the world by storm when it first launched in November 2022, quickly becoming one of the streaming platform’s most-watched original series of all time (second only to Squid Game). Centring on sharp and sardonic school girl Wednesday Addams (Jenna Ortega), the series whisks us off to the supremely eerie Nevermore Academy where she hopes to hone her emerging psychic skills. Meanwhile Wednesday finds herself dead in the middle of twisted mysteries with grave consequences, all while she navigates new school friends – and foes.
Set in Vermont, Wednesday season 1 was filmed in the more aptly gothic Romania in the winter of 2021 to 2022, with more than 70 sets and six soundstages utilised and filming locations across Bucharest. Flash forward to 2025, and the second season is officially streaming in full after a three year delay. Renewed for season 3 in July, is another three year wait on the cards for our next Wednesday dose? It seems not… Here’s what we know so far.

Wednesday Season 3: Plot, Cast, Release Date & More
It’s official: as of 23 July 2025, Wednesday season 3 has the greenlight. The news was revealed by Netflix just days before the first half of season 2 of the hit gothic drama launched on the platform at the start of August, with co-creator and showrunner Alfred Gough commenting: ‘I have been doing this long enough to know that shows like this don’t come along every day. It’s such an alchemy of writing, directing, acting, crew, streamer, studio, and fans.’

Based on the characters created by cartoonist Charles Addams in his New Yorker comic strip The Addams Family (which ran from 1938 until his death in 1988), Wednesday stars rising scream queen Jenna Ortega in the title role, joined by Catherine Zeta-Jones as her mother Morticia, Luis Guzman as her father Gomez, and Isaac Ordonez as her younger brother Pugsley.
Elsewhere at Nevermore Academy, Emma Myers plays Wednesday’s colourful werewolf roommate Enid Sinclair, plus Christina Ricci as Marilyn Thornhill, having previously portrayed Wednesday Addams herself in The Addams Family (1991) and Addams Family Values (1993).

What Will Happen?
No news just yet on the plot of Wednesday season 3, but part two gave us some more clues. One thing we know for sure is that Ortega will return in the leading titular role, and she will most likely return to Nevermore Academy for more twisted hijinks.
At the end of season 2, we saw the spectre of the mysterious Ophelia (Morticia’s long-lost sister) scrawling ‘Wednesday must die’ on a wall – surely a portent for the events of season 3. Throughout season 2, it was teased (via Morticia) that Ophelia went missing after losing control of her powers as a Raven – a disturbing parallel with Wednesday who lost her psychic abilities, too. However at the end of season 2, when Morticia hands Wednesday Ophelia’s journal, those powers come flooding back. The gothic teen sees a dreadful vision: Ophelia locked away in a dungeon-like room in Grandmama Hester Frump’s (Joanna Lumley) mansion.
It’s clear that Hester is hiding more than we bargained for, while Isadora’s (Billie Piper) motives also seem more twisted than ever. Luckily for us, both characters will return for the third instalment after making their debuts in season 2.

Wednesday season 2 expanded the Addams Family lore and introduced a whole host of intriguing new characters. The series’ co-creator and co-showrunner Miles Millar teases: ‘We will be seeing more Addams Family members and learning more family secrets in season 3!’
And off the back of season 2 delving into darker and more complex stories, we can only assume season 3 will follow the same pattern. Bad things come in threes, after all.
‘Our goal for Season 3 is the same as it is for every season: to make it the best season of Wednesday we possibly can,’ says Gough. ‘We want to continue digging deeper into our characters while expanding the world of Nevermore and Wednesday,’ adding: ‘Wednesday season 1 was a table setter, but there’s still so much of the world left to see. It’s been exciting to expand the scope and the vision of the show this season.’
One thing we know for sure? After a glimpse of her at the end of season 2, Ophelia is set to appear properly in season 3. ‘The reemergence of Ophelia is going to hit this family like a bomb,’ Gough teases. ‘It was always the plan to give viewers a glimpse of her at the end of the season in a way that they weren’t expecting, and then that’s a driver into Season 3.’

Who Will Star?
A fresh face will join the cast of Wednesday season 3: French star Eva Green as the long-missing Ophelia Frump (aka Aunt Ophelia). She joins the season as the missing sister of Morticia Addams, whose ghostly absence loomed over season 2. Green – who has previously worked with director Tim Burton on Dark Shadows (2012), Miss Peregrine’s Home for Peculiar Children (2016) and Dumbo (2016) – says she is ‘thrilled to join the woefully twisted world of Wednesday’.
‘This show is such a deliciously dark and witty world,’ the actor adds. ‘I can’t wait to bring my own touch of cuckoo-ness to the Addams family.’
She will be joined by lead star Jenna Ortega, as well as Emma Myers, Hunter Doohan and newcomers Joanna Lumley and Billie Piper. The full cast we know so far is as follows:
- Jenna Ortega as Wednesday Addams
- Emma Myers as Enid Sinclair
- Hunter Doohan as Tyler Galpin
- Joy Sunday as Bianca Barclay
- Moosa Mostafa as Eugene Ottinger
- Georgie Farmer as Ajax Petropolus
- Isaac Ordonez as Pugsley Addams
- Billie Piper as Isadora Capri
- Luyanda Unati Lewis-Nyawo as Sheriff Ritchie Santiago
- Victor Dorobantu as Thing
- Evie Templeton as Agnes DeMille
- Luis Guzmán as Gomez Addams
- Catherine Zeta-Jones as Morticia Addams
- Joanna Lumley as Grandmama Hester Frump
- Fred Armisen as Uncle Fester

Release Date
No specific release date just yet, but filming for Wednesday season 3 is scheduled to begin in February 2026, five months after season 2 part 3 landed on Netflix. This is much speedier than the commencement of season 2 filming, which did not begin until a year and a half after season 1 launched.
This is a four month delay from the original schedule, in which filming was planned to commence in November 2025, just two months after season 2 part 2 launched.
If all goes to plan, Wednesday season 3 could launch in early 2027; naturally our fingers are crossed for even sooner.
